<p>Another show I&#8217;ve recently discovered is <em>Tabatha&#8217;s Salon Takeover</em> on Bravo. Hair stylist and salon owner Tabatha Coffey was a contestant on another Bravo show <em>Shear Genius</em>, though I never watched it. The show is now in its second season, the premise being that Tabatha will go in to a failing salon and attempt to save the business with her one week &#8220;takeover&#8221; plan. The interesting thing to me about this show is that the salon owners have obviously contacted Bravo on their own, but when Tabatha gets there they are often extremely resistant to her help. And Tabatha is not a nice, polite, flexible sort of person. It&#8217;s her way or the highway. She&#8217;s very tough on the salon and the employees but with the best interests of the business in mind. There&#8217;s always someone she&#8217;s butting heads with, but to me she&#8217;s like a breath of fresh air in a world where everyone is always trying to be so PC and careful with their words. She&#8217;s not afraid of confrontation, and let&#8217;s face it &#8211; that makes for good TV. <em>Tabatha&#8217;s Salon Takeover</em> airs Tuesday nights at 10 pm EST on Bravo, though you can usually catch the reruns during the weekend.</p>

What I do still watch on TLC is <em>Say Yes to the Dress</em>, which gives the viewer an inside look into the business of high-priced wedding gowns at Kleinfeld&#8217;s in New York City. This show is just fun, though the cost of the dresses will make you a bit sick. They sell a lot of gowns that cost more than my car. You&#8217;ll &#8220;ooooooh&#8221; and &#8220;ahhhhh&#8221;, you might get teary-eyed along with the bride who finds her perfect dress and you&#8217;ll probably roll your eyes at some of the girls who are a little bit like Rachel Zoe&#8217;s old stylist. <em>Say Yes to the Dress</em> airs Fridays at 9 pm EST on TLC, though you can almost always find mini-marathons on Saturday and Sunday afternoons. <p>1. <em>Nine</em> &#8211; if you can rent this in the $1 Redbox in a few months then it might be worthwhile. Otherwise, it sucked. I was so disappointed because there are all these amazing actresses starring, but it&#8217;s really just sort of strange and hard to follow. I loved the idea of the movie, a director trying to make a comeback with a film that spotlights the important women in his life. Nicole Kidman, Penelope Cruz, Kate Hudson, Marion Cotillard, Judi Dench and Fergie all play these women who make an impact on him. They played their roles fabulously, as did Daniel Day-Lewis in the lead role of Guido Contini. The story itself was just lacking. Don&#8217;t pay the $10 to see this in the theatre. It&#8217;s totally not worth it.</p>

<p>3. <em>Julie and Julia</em> &#8211; I hadn&#8217;t originally wanted to see this movie, but I&#8217;m glad I did. I don&#8217;t think it&#8217;s worthy of any awards, other than Meryl Streep&#8217;s dead-on portrayal of Julia Child. If someone decided to make a feature-length film about Julia Child&#8217;s life, they better darn well cast Streep. She was amazing. I&#8217;d see that movie in the theatre for sure. I was completely engrossed in the portions of the film which detailed Child&#8217;s life, but didn&#8217;t find myself having the same emotional attachment to Amy Adams&#8217; character Julie Powell. Nothing again Adams, I think she&#8217;s a fine actress. It was just that part of the story wasn&#8217;t that engaging. However, I think this was definitely worth the rental price as just a cute film. It won&#8217;t change your life, but it&#8217;ll keep you entertained for an hour and a half. It might even inspire you to buy one of Child&#8217;s cookbooks and try something new. Bon Appetit!</p>
